2 Zion News monthly - October W. 8th St - Davenport IA page 2 from the Pastor God s Word forever shall abide, no thanks to foes, who fear it; for God himself fights by our side with weapons of the Spirit. the kingdom s ours forever! ELW #504 Do you know who wrote this 4 th verse of one of the most well-known hymns in the Lutheran Church? Do you know who was a professor at the University of Wittenberg, in Germany in the 1500 s? Do you know who translated the Bible into German? These are just a few fun facts about Martin Luther, one of the men whose study of the Bible resulted in a new way to be Church. Together,with many others, Martin Luther sought to reform the Catholic Church of the 16 th century. One result of the Reformation was the formation of the Lutheran Church. We will be celebrating the work of all reformers for the next year. One of Luther s gifts to the Church was formulating a doctrine that recognizes God s grace, rather than our works, in freeing us from the chains of sin. As followers of Jesus, our works continue his work. But they do not determine our salvation. God does/has already. That s why our t-shirts and ELCA logos say, God s work, our hands. Fred Pratt Green wrote, in ELW #729, The church of Christ, in every age, beset by change, but Spirit-led, must claim and test its heritage and keep on rising from the dead. If we claim to be part of a reforming church, and we do, we give thanks for our heritage, understand how that history has formed us, and then we keep on rising from the dead; we let the Spirit stir us, disturb us, guide, and protect us from all that keeps us separated from the love of God, in Christ Jesus our Lord. We can be confident of the Spirit s work because God s Word forever shall abide, and, God fights by our side. If anything or anyone tries to get in the way of that love, they cannot win the day, because the kingdom s ours forever. Hallelujah! We look forward to a year of learning, or maybe refreshing our memories of the gifts of the Reformation. We also look forward to considering how the Reformation continues in our lives today.
